Please post your 2018 Operational Upgrade Experiences in this thread.

Around the middle of 2016, Emirates modified their Operational Upgrade Policy favouring type of ticket over status holders, giving non status passengers on Flex and Flex Plus tickets an advantage over (for example) Silver members on a Saver ticket. During the latter half of 2016, less Op Ups were reported but we would still like to hear when they happen.

Upgrade given: Y - J
Upgrade location: Lounge
Route: DXB-BUD
Flight number: EK111
Type of ticket: ECONOMY FLEX
Date of travel: 2nd March 2018
Tier status: Gold
Tier miles to date: c.70k
Skywards miles balance: c.25k
Number of pax on the same PNR (Including OP): 1
Number of pax upgraded: 1

The flight was -14 in Y the day before so I reckoned I had a decent chance of a op-up being on flex. I was at the lounge and around T-90 minutes I got a text (and email) saying I was upgraded. Collected my boarding pass in the lounge, changed my seat and was off to the races.

NRT-DXB

28 Feb, 18
EK319 NRT-DXB as first segment of NRT-MAN
Economy Flex Plus to Business
Skywards Gold, approx 80K miles.
Upgraded while in lounge, when I went to reception to ask about on time status. Otherwise would have been upgraded at gate, I think.
Had been offered upgrade (cabin only, no extra baggage or miles) by email 3 days before for Ł360 but did not take it up.
